It was the Trinity Sessions that put them on the map and is an "audiophile" favorite, for good reason. Recorded live to a single stereo mike in one long take in a church in Toronto. It is exceptional, except for the AC unit making all that nose sometimes!! As mentioned above, they do a sweet "Sweet Jane", which Lou Reed called the best version he had heard :)

I would also second "All That Reckoning", a lot more recent (and there is lots of good stuff between these two). It is great and rocks in a way that many of the others do not.
